Now, officially our choice for QTerminal (with QTermWidget) is the official terminal of LXQT, replacing LXTerminal, and has been incorporated to the LXQT project, although keeping independent release cicle [1]. It already was the choice in Fedora LXQt [2]. Before, the official one was LXTerminal. Next release will be available on downloads.lxqt.org and it is promised they will be "pushing harder for fixes and polishing on it" [1].
